The aim of this study is to propose a sky radiance distribution model for all sky conditions from clear sky to overcast sky. In the previous paper, the indices to estimate sky radiance distributions were examined based on the measurement data in Tokyo and Fukuoka by IDMP of CIE. The normalized global irradiance and cloudless index were selected as indices to estimate sky radiance distributions. This paper proposes a numerical equation named All Sky Model - R to show sky radiance distributions for all sky conditions as functions of these indices. The All Sky Model - R was compared with the measurement values of sky radiance distributions, and its high accuracy was confirmed. Moreover, the vertical global irradiances from the estimation of the All Sky Model - R, Isotropic model and Perez model were compared with the measurement values. It was confirmed that the All Sky Model - R gives smallest RMSE values and reproduces actual phenomenon of the sky accurately.
